Ticket #—Locked Vault, Pindrop Secrets Store. The vault holding our dependency-pinning manifests sealed itself after three failed unlock attempts during the Thornbury release. Support cannot update pinned versions until it is reopened, and the pinning policy forbids unpinned builds as a workaround. Per the recovery procedure, a single custodian may unseal it manually. Enter the recovery passphrase given immediately below into the unseal prompt.

vault phrase of bagaf-kajeg = jorath-feniel-briir-siliel-ralix

Facilities Ticket — Cleaning Crew Access, Brindle Annex

For new starters handling evening lock-up: the Sorano Cleaning crew arrives nightly at 21:30 via the annex side door. Check their rota sheet, note arrival in the log, and ensure the storeroom is relocked afterward. To let them through the side door, enter the access code below.

badge for yaweg-hafog: bdg-GX-6

Ticket #4471 — Signature check failing on Socketree reconnect patch

Plugin authors: v2.9.1 fixes the websocket reconnect loop (clients hammering the broker after idle timeout). Several of you report signature verification failures on the new bundle. Cause: we rotated keys last sprint and docs lagged. Rebuild against the 2.9 SDK and re-verify. Verify your downloads against the current signing key below:

release key, yagap-kagag: bky6_1ks93y

Subject: Locked case – Fenlow test units

Hi dispatch,

The locked case with the Fenlow test devices is ready at the Ridgemoor lab. It goes out on tomorrow's first run with Arrowane. Case stays locked end to end — key travels separately. When the driver takes custody, make sure they follow this:

handover note for yagef-bagep: the drudor pelius courier leaves the kasdor zorvan norir ledger at gate 8016 under passcode 755406

# Consent banner rollout constants (Project Aldergate).
# Support team: these govern how long the banner waits before
# re-prompting, and the percentage of visitors in each rollout
# cohort. If a customer reports seeing the banner repeatedly,
# check these before filing a bug with the Bramleyfield team.
# The active values for this release are set immediately below.

constants for bawif-kawif:
QUOTAS = {
    "ulaael": 5,
    "holael": 10,
}